This depth means most people easily reach the back of the counter. Bathrooms tend to have smaller and narrower counters, especially since people will lean over them to inspect their face regularly; they measure between 19.5 and 22.5 inches deep.

Web23 de jan. de 2024 · NONA. Worktop and island depth. A standard worktop is 60cm deep, following the dimensions of standard appliances. A working island will have a minimum depth of 60cm. Add an extra 30cm to accommodate either stools or shallow storage, or 60cm if you wish to accommodate both or if you prefer deep storage on either side.
